What a Mental Health Support Officer Actually Does

The title differs. Some organisations make use of peer advocate, mental health responder, psychological health and wellness first aider, or wellbeing call. The core jobs look similar:

    Recognise early warning signs of distress and damage, then take part in a risk-free, thoughtful discussion to assess instant needs. Conduct a basic danger check for self-destruction, self-harm, or injury to others, and enact an agreed strategy to alleviate risk. Keep the individual safe in the moment, after that rise appropriately to specialist assistance, emergency solutions, or internal medical teams. Document what occurred, debrief, and feed understandings back right into plan or environmental adjustments that decrease future harm.

That mix of acknowledgment, action, and recommendation is the DNA of crisis mental health operate at the non-clinical degree. It is not therapy. It is not a diagnostic role. It is quick, sensible assistance lined up with duty-of-care and the organisation's acceleration framework.

What is a Mental Health And Wellness Crisis?

Definitions matter when legal obligations and safety are on the line. Virtually, a mental health crisis is any scenario where a person's thoughts, mood, or habits position a prompt danger to their safety and security or the security of others, or where they can not operate in their typical functions without intense assistance. Instances range extensively: a staff member pacing and incoherent after 3 sleepless evenings, a young adult sharing intent to end their life, a commuter experiencing an anxiety attack on a stuffed train, an expert with flashbacks in a loud warehouse.

Crises differ in strength and threat. Some resolve with basing strategies, quiet area, and a helpful conversation. Others need emergency solutions. The skill of a qualified support police officer depends on differentiating the difference rapidly and compassionately, after that complying with an exercised, accredited procedure to stabilize the situation.

The 11379NAT Path: First Response to a Mental Health Crisis

If you are mapping a path for ending up being a mental health support officer in Australia, the 11379NAT course in initial response to a mental health crisis is a foundational choice. This nationally accredited training concentrates on the initial minutes and hours of situation action for non-clinical team. The 11379NAT mental health course, often described as the mental health course 11379NAT, gears up individuals to identify dilemma indicators, give first aid for mental health, and coordinate risk-free escalation.

At its core, the 11379NAT course in initial response to a mental health crisis covers:

    Recognition of dilemma signs throughout anxiousness, anxiety, psychosis, substance-related distress, trauma responses, and complicated grief. Practical de-escalation and communication strategies to reduce frustration without revoking the person. Suicide threat identification, immediate security preparation, and emergency situation recommendation thresholds. Cultural, lawful, and moral considerations, including privacy, consent, and when to break discretion for safety. Documentation, debriefing, and self-care strategies to limit exhaustion and vicarious trauma.

Delivery varies across registered training organisations. Anticipate combined discovering with situation job, duty play, and competency-based assessment. Accredited training indicates you are analyzed on your ability to demonstrate abilities under sensible problems, not just your capability to pass a quiz.

Working Along with Clinicians

Support policemans are not a substitute for clinical care. The most effective teams build clean handovers. Clinicians require succinct, precise detail: what was stated verbatim regarding threat, what the atmosphere was like, what interventions were tried, and how the person reacted. Accredited training instructs you to record without conjecture and to avoid language that classifies or diagnoses.

Trust flows both methods. When medical professionals recognize your training is certified and existing, they depend on your observations. I have had psychiatrists request our assistance policeman's notes when they prepped for evaluation, because they caught the initial hour of the crisis before adrenaline and shame altered the narrative.

Cost, Time, and Practical Considerations

Most accredited mental health courses range from one to 3 days. The 11379NAT commonly entails pre-reading, an one or two day workshop, and expertise analysis. Prices differ across providers and areas, however as a wide range, anticipate a per-person fee equivalent to other country wide recognized brief programs. Group bookings often minimize the per-seat expense, and some companies safe and secure funding with market bodies or federal government grants.

It is reasonable to compute indirect prices too. Drawing staff off the floor affects procedures. Construct cover right into rostering, and schedule debrief time after scenario-heavy days, when adrenaline dips and exhaustion increases. On the internet components can reduce traveling time, yet make certain the sensible analysis continues to be robust. Dilemma abilities are muscle memory as high as understanding, which calls for actual practice.
